WebCCRN-K ™ (Pediatric) is a specialty certification for nurses who influence the care delivered to acutely/ critically ill pediatric patients but do not primarily or exclusively provide direct care. Nurses working in roles such as clinical educator, manager/supervisor, director, academic faculty or nursing administrator may be eligible. Webcertification resources As you prepare to take your Pediatric Nursing Certification (PNC) exam or to re-certify, SPN has a variety of tools and resources available to help support … WebOct 4, 2024 · The Pediatric Nursing Certification Board requires 1800 hours of pediatric nursing experience within the last two years. The American Nurses Credentialing Center requires 2000 hours of pediatric nursing experience within the last three years and 30 hours of continuing education. How Much Do Pediatric Nurses Make? WebAccording to the American Nurses Association, 92% of pediatric nurses are satisfied or very satisfied with their work, compared to 84% for all registered nurses. An estimated 180,000 registered nurses provide patient care to a pediatric population. 30% of certified pediatric nurses work in free-standing children’s hospitals. WebAccording to the Institute of Pediatric Nursing, pediatric registered nurses (RNs) work in a variety of settings, including the following: Free-standing children’s hospitals: 30.3%. Children’s hospitals associated with major medical centers: 28.3%. Outpatient specialty care: 11.7%. Community hospitals: 9.9%.
